Mesothelioma Claims

A mesothelioma suit is a legal action that seeks financial compensation from asbestos victims. Compensation can be awarded via mesothelioma lawsuits, a settlement for mesothelioma attorneys, or a payout from the asbestos trust fund.

The process is complicated and lengthy, however using a reputable law firm can make it simpler for the victims and their families. Compensation can be used to pay for medical expenses and other costs related to mesothelioma.

Time limit

The deadline for filing mesothelioma lawsuits is determined by a variety of factors. The date of diagnosis, as well as the condition of the exposure are key factors. The law stipulates that victims must file a lawsuit within the statute of limitations or risk losing their right to compensation. To avoid not meeting the deadline, patients should consult an experienced mesothelioma lawyer as quickly as they can.

State-by-state, the time of limitations for mesothelioma differs. However, most mesothelioma lawsuits are required to be filed within a period of one to three years following a diagnosis or victim's death. This is due to the long time of mesothelioma's latency and other asbestos-related diseases.

In addition to mesothelioma lawsuits, certain victims could also be entitled to compensation from trust funds and veterans' benefits. These options typically move much faster than mesothelioma lawsuits and may not require the filing of a lawsuit.
